Sahmalpur
Sahmalpur is a village located in Surajgarha subdivision of Lakhisarai district in Bihar,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Surajgarha (tehsildar office) and 30km away from district headquarter Lakhisarai. As per 2009 stats, Madanpur is the gram panchayat of Sahmalpur village.

About Sahmalpur
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sahmalpur is 243493. The village spans a total geographical area of 17.19 hectares. Lakhisarai is nearest town to Sahmalp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 30km away.

Population of Sahmalpur
According to the 2011 Census, Sahmalpur has a total population of about 1,055, with approximately 561 males and 494 females. The sex ratio is around 880 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 209 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 182 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 49.19%, with male literacy at about 58.47% and female literacy near 38.66%. There are around 202 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,055 | 561 | 494 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 209 | 108 | 101 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 182 | 101 | 81 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 519 | 328 | 191 |
Illiterate Population | 536 | 233 | 303 |
Connectivity of Sahmalpur
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sahmalpur. As per the 2011 stats, Sahmalp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within <5 km distance |
